How they compare

Lebanon currently reports 9,700 against 3,114 in Venezuela, a difference of 6,586.

That makes Lebanon's figure about 3.1 times Venezuela's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 10 shared years of data; in 2007 it was Lebanon ahead.

Lebanon ranks 1st and Venezuela ranks 2nd of 157 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Lebanon averaged higher in 1 and Venezuela in 1.
